As we age, the skin is naturally robbed of its youth. Unfortunately, age catches up with the skin faster than it does with us. While we may only be in the late thirties, it is not rare to find skin that looks well nearing fifty. The problem of ageing skin is faced by almost everyone.
The skin starts to age faster as the cells cannot care for themselves and reproduce as they did in youth. Moisture is lost faster, and hormonal changes in the body cause the skin to get affected adversely. In such circumstances, it is common to rush for medical intervension in the hope that age will be reversed. There are more practical, simple ways to deal with this phenomenon.
Make changes in your lifestyle. Try and live closer to nature. Take long walks near either the sea, or in open parks. Calm yourself down and spend some time in meditation. Regular exercise is also important for the skin. Yoga is known to work wonders for the body in fighting ageing and keeping it toned and young.
Regularise food intake. Eat on time, and make sure you switch to more healthy foods if you have been indulging yourself. Choose foods that are not fried, low in fats and avoid red meat as far as possible. The ability of the skin to lose oils is lowered and it cannot take these large peoportions of fat. Detoxify the system with as much fluid intake as possible.
Start with the juice if carrot, mint, corriander and celery every morning and it will refresh the system instantly. Green tea is also known to be highly beneficial. Try and reduce the intake of alcohol. Increase the intake of fresh fruit and vegetables. Make sure you add at least two helpings of fresh fruit and vegetables daily. Avoid adding artificial sugars to it.
While selected products for the face, try and use those made from natural products. Aloe, jojoba, dead sea and rainforest products are all available today and make better options for the skin since chemicals do not go well with ageing skin.
The most important factor is your own attitude. Be positive and happy and that reflects well on the skin. Gracefully embracing age and tackling it in the correct manner will put most problems to rest.
